首页 > web前端 > js教程 > 如何在不使用 `` 标签的情况下在页面加载时运行函数?

如何在不使用 `` 标签的情况下在页面加载时运行函数?

Barbara Streisand
发布: 2024-11-16 07:00:03
原创
794 人浏览过

How Can I Run a Function on Page Load Without Using the `` Tag?

在不使用

的情况下在页面加载时运行函数标签

当尝试在页面加载时执行函数而不使用

时标签,用户可能会遇到一些阻力。尽管采用了各种方法,该功能仍然处于非活动状态。本文将深入探讨该问题,并提供一个可行的解决方案,确保该函数按预期执行。

window.onload 的用法

一个潜在的问题通常建议的解决方案是利用 window.onload 事件处理程序。通过将该函数分配给该处理程序,它应该在页面完全加载时执行。但是,在某些情况下,此方法可能无法按预期运行。

工作脚本

为了说明如何有效地使用 window.onload,请考虑以下代码片段:

<!DOCTYPE html>
<html>
    <head>
        <title>Test</title>
        <me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
        <script type="text/javascript">
        function codeAddress() {
            alert('ok');
        }
        window.onload = codeAddress;
        </script>
    </head>
    <body>

    </body>
</html>
登录后复制

在此代码中,codeAddress 函数负责在页面加载时显示警报。执行此代码时,页面完全加载时将成功调用该函数。

结论

虽然

标签是在页面加载时执行功能的一种简单方法,它不是唯一可用的选项。本文演示了如何利用 window.onload 来实现相同的结果,为 的情况提供了一个可行的替代方案。标签不合适。

以上是如何在不使用 `` 标签的情况下在页面加载时运行函数?的详细内容。更多信息请关注PHP中文网其他相关文章!

来源:php.cn
本站声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
作者最新文章
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板